Theater J Annual Benefit Performance Announced
by A.A. Cristi - Oct 28, 2019
Theater J's 2019 Annual Benefit Performance is an unforgettable evening of musical theater at the newly renovated Edlavitch DCJCC on November 18 at 6:30 PM. The centerpiece of the event, which also includes food, drink, and socializing, is a special musical performance of After Anatevka: a Novel Based on a?oeFiddler on the Roofa?? written and performed by Grammy-nominated artist and author Alexandra Silber. Silber, who has appeared in Fiddler on the Roof on Broadway (directed by Bartlett Sher) and the West End, imagines what happens to Sholem Alecheim's beloved characters of Fiddler on the Roof after they step off stage. The performance features new songs composed by some of the top rising talent in musical theater today and sung by the gifted Silber, who recently played Sally Bowles in Cabaret at Olney Theatre Center.

Fun Facts About All 41 Broadway Theatres
by Nicole Rosky - May 11, 2019
What makes a Broadway theatre? Technically any venue with 500 seats or more, located along Broadway in New York City's Theatre District is a Broadway theatre, and the art that is produced in these special places is widely considered the highest form of theatrical entertainment in the world. Today, forty-one theatres are technically Broadway houses, each with their own rich history. Below, we're giving you the scoop on the life of every one of them!
